The RSV genome and antigenome/mRNAs are m6A methylated. a Distribution of m6A peaks in the RSV antigenome and genome of virions grown in HeLa cells. Confluent HeLa cells were infected by rgRSV at an MOI of 1.0, supernatant was harvested at 36 h post-infection. RSV virions were purified by sucrose gradient ultracentrifugation. Total RNAs were extracted from purified virions and were subjected to m6A-specific antibody immunoprecipitation followed by high-throughput sequencing (m6A-seq). A schematic diagram of partial RSV antigenome (complementary to regions from the leader sequence to M2-2 gene) is shown, as most m6A peaks are clustered in these regions. m6A sites in full-length antigenome and genome are shown in Supplementary Fig. 2. The normalized coverage from m6A-seq of RSV RNA showing the distribution of m6A-immunoprecipitated (IP) reads mapped to the RSV antigenome (blue block) and genome (pink block). The baseline distributions for antigenome and genome from input sample are shown as a blue and pink line respectively. Data presented are the averages from two independent virion samples (n = 2). b Distribution of m6A peaks in the RSV mRNAs from RSV-infected HeLa cells. Confluent HeLa cells were infected by rgRSV at an MOI of 1.0, cell lysates were harvested at 36 h post-infection. Total RNAs were extracted from cell lysates, and were enriched for mRNA by binding to oligo dT, and subjected to m6A-seq. The distribution of m6A-immunoprecipitated (IP) reads were mapped to the RSV mRNAs (pink block). The baseline distributions for mRNAs from input sample are shown as a pink line. Data presented are the averages from two independent virus-infected HeLa cell samples (n = 2). c Distribution of m6A peaks in the RSV antigenome and genome of virions grown in A549 cells.
